This book is a must have for people looking to learn more about how to please your mate. This is not a book about "submission" or anything of the such. It explains the male and female body functions, how and why they function, what to do to get pleasure out of "the act of marriage". This book also gives the wife and husbands pointers on turn offs and turn ons. It's a great book to enhance your knowlege in the bed in a very decent text. I think all people can learn from this book. It's got common sense and points out things people would never know about with out researching the human body on their own.

This book is a fascinating read. I have never read something thoroughly and yet delicately explains the inner workings of the sexual organs, the sex act, and everything leading up to it. It also contains great information on building a strong marriage, communicating with your spouse, and giving each other the best possible experience in bed and throughout your daily lives together.This book was essential in the early days of my marriage. Both my husband and I read it and learned a lot from it. We still go back to it as a reference from time to time. We have two copies, so that if we ever lend one out, we've always got one at home! I have no idea what a previous reviewer meant when they said that it was anti-female. Perhaps they read a different book and thought it was this one? This book focuses on TENDER, COMPASSIONATE, UNSELFISH love for both husband and wife. It gives pointers on many things that are not often talked about, and overall, this is one of the best marriage/sex books I have ever read. I would highly recommend this to anyone who is thinking of getting married, has recently married, or who has already been married for 75 years. If you want insight into your relationship and sexual lives, including ways to add more spark to both, this is the book you've been looking for.
